Tired-looking Russian defence minister Sergei Shoigu, 66, appears on TV
Sergei Shoigu, 66, appeared tired with a raspy voice in a broadcasted meeting. The Russian defence minister read from notes in an apparent crisis session. There is also speculation that Shoigu had sought to resign at the start of the war.
